Arrowhead Narrative Director explains Liberty Day

To preface, the official Helldivers 2 X account posted a message, stating: “Liberty Day is almost here! All recruits are ordered to watch the mandatory briefing on the History of Liberty Day. And remember: this isn’t just a holiday — it’s a celebration of Managed Democracy!”

Along with the message, there’s a link to an older video in which Nils Hansson Bjerke, the Narrative Lead at Arrowhead, goes on to explain a little bit of lore behind the celebration. He gives us a little bit of background about how Managed Democracy came to power on Super Earth and what the Liberty Day celebration encompasses. It’s filled with tongue-in-cheek humour that we’ve come to expect in Helldivers 2, as well as fun images to go along with the narrative. We especially loved the burning robot surrounded by gifts. The Liberty Day celebration is set to occur in just a few days, on Saturday, October 26. The community is excited to find out what the devs have cooked up for the occasion.
